How Foster Parent School Resources Help Children Thrive

January 22, 2026 by Lata Leave a Comment

Every child deserves a fair chance to learn and grow. For children in foster care, school can feel confusing and overwhelming. New homes often mean new classrooms, new teachers, and new rules and  these changes can affect learning and confidence.

The good news is that strong school resources can make a real difference. When the right help is in place, children feel seen, supported, and ready to succeed. Read on to learn how these resources help foster children thrive each day.

How Foster Parent School Resources Help Children Thrive

Stability Creates a Sense of Safety

Children learn best when they feel safe. Foster parent school resources help create steady routines. They support smooth school moves and help children settle faster.

Familiar schedules and clear expectations reduce stress. When children feel safe, they can focus. They are more likely to ask questions and try new tasks and this sense of stability builds trust and helps children believe school can be a positive place.

Better Communication Builds Strong Bridges

Clear communication helps everyone work as a team. School resources often guide foster parents on how to talk with teachers and staff. This keeps adults informed and aligned.

When schools understand a child’s needs, they can respond with care. Teachers can offer patience and extra help when needed. This shared effort supports learning and emotional growth through steady school support for foster parents, that keeps the child’s best interests in focus.

Emotional Support Shapes Learning

Many foster children carry emotional stress. School based resources can offer counseling and guidance. These services help children process feelings in healthy ways.

When emotions are supported, learning improves and children feel calmer and more open. They can focus on lessons instead of worries. Emotional care helps children build confidence and a positive self image.

Extra Academic Help Fills Learning Gaps

Frequent moves can cause learning gaps. School resources help identify these gaps early. Tutors and special programs offer targeted support.

This extra help keeps children from falling behind. It also shows them that their growth matters. When children see progress, they gain pride in their work and feel motivated to keep learning.

Support for Foster Parents Strengthens Outcomes

Foster parents play a key role in school success. Resources help them understand school systems and rights. They offer tools to support homework and routines at home.

When foster parents feel informed, they feel empowered. This confidence helps them advocate for the child. Strong support at home and school leads to better results and stronger bonds.

Collaboration Creates Long Term Success

Success grows when systems work together. Schools, caregivers, and social workers each play a part. Resources help align goals and share information.

This teamwork helps children feel supported from all sides. It creates a clear path forward and reduces confusion. Over time, this steady care builds resilience and hope.

Helping Children Grow Beyond the Classroom

School resources do more than improve grades and they help children build life skills. They teach trust, routine, and self-belief. These lessons last well beyond the school years.

When foster children receive the right support, they begin to thrive. They learn that change does not have to mean loss. With care, guidance, and patience, school can become a place of growth, strength, and new beginnings.
